These approved runs show what LlamaGen delivered from real controlled inputs: a finished 12-page story, eight recurring characters across 40 panels, and one chapter adapted to three comic reading formats.
Every card links to the canonical evidence page with input, generation date, output counts, first-pass definition, revisions, methodology, known defects, and an immutable evidence hash.

The run used an original screenplay and six recurring characters, then retained the complete PDF, CBZ, page images, first-review decisions, and targeted redraw history.
16 revision events repaired 15 unique panels before the final 12-page delivery was approved.
Known limitation
Minor distant-face variation remains, and authored text is placed in a bottom band instead of speech balloons.
Evidence SHA-256 111e16d6f5ba2b978e2b8460906bc81e3de74acafa3977a3b1a69693c3c58fc4

The ten-page benchmark publishes all 40 panels, the character registry, every identity score, three visible first-pass failures, and the repaired final delivery.
Three targeted redraws moved the final result from 37/40 to 40/40 accepted panels.
Known limitation
Fine mechanical hand geometry and small identity accessories still show disclosed minor variation.
Evidence SHA-256 98c7d95e7fe7663b99d3ae8f482ad6583c281c7a8a836d68d40e8c819ab1d636

The same twelve story moments and four recurring characters were independently composed for Japanese manga, Western comic, and vertical Webtoon reading.
All story panels passed first review after four early character-reference replacements.
Known limitation
The three formats were separate controlled runs, not a one-click layout export claim.
Evidence SHA-256 8b0e234e65cfc359ba29e1a060ee5fffeb82463a41a01e3a7da2d5f1cb461f55
These are observed controlled runs, not guaranteed acceptance rates for every prompt. Exact settled provider cost and active human review time were not captured except where explicitly disclosed.

Text to manga means turning a written scene into a readable manga page. Start with a premise, chapter beat, dialogue exchange, or full script, then generate manga panels with panel order, captions, framing, and story movement.
A manga page workflow should connect story notes, character assets, manga panels, covers, and page layout. Use the AI manga generator when the project starts with text, then continue into Manga Maker for bubbles, layout editing, and finished pages.
Black-and-white manga generation works best when prompts include classic ink, screentone, contrast, close-ups, panel rhythm, and caption intent. This helps the result feel like a Japanese manga storyboard rather than a generic monochrome image.
